Dogs' anal glands always leak smelly water. This is usually caused by not having the dog's anal glands squeezed for a long time. You need to squeeze the dog's anal glands in time, otherwise it will easily cause the anal glands to become blocked and inflamed, affecting the dog's body. healthy. If your dog has anal redness and swelling, difficulty in defecation, anal odor, frequent licking of the anus, rubbing on the butt, chasing butt bites, etc., then it means that the dog has anal gland problems, and it is best to send it to the doctor for examination and treatment in time.
